Reiki Energy Healing
The word "reiki" comes from the Japanese words for "life force energy." Reiki is a form of energy healing in which the practitioner's hands, placed in specified positions on or an inch or two above the client's fully clothed body, interact with and work to realign the client's energy pathways. Reiki is gentle, non-invasive, and deeply relaxing.
